Clinical Psychology degrees abroad
Clinical psychology is the process of assessing and treating patients for a range of conditions that have an affect on mental health and well-being. Clinical psychology programs are often vocational degrees that explore the treatments and support you can give patients to help with specific conditions.


Clinical Psychology program structure
Clinical psychology degrees are usually only available as postgraduate programs. Once you have a bachelor’s in psychology or a relevant major you can progress to a master’s or PhD focused on this area of health and medicine.
However, in the UK, some universities have the option of studying the subject at bachelor’s level as part of a psychology degree or as a standalone degree.
A doctorate or PhD program in clinical psychology may require you to create an extensive research paper and new contribution to the subject, extensive practical training and assessments, as well as exams.
It’s likely that a clinical psychology program will entail work experience or a placement year to ensure that you have plenty of practical experience. The theoretical modules included within a clinical psychology program will vary depending on the university, but will revolve around topics such as:
- Research
- Cognition
- Development
- Individual differences
- Neurophysiological disorders
- Diagnosis
- Conditions and treatments

Future clinical psychology careers
Clinical psychology is useful for graduates who want to enter social care or medical psychology roles such as:
- Counseling psychologist
- Mental health social worker
- School counselor or psychologist
- Rehab psychologist
- Medical psychologist
Graduates may also want to consider following an academic career path and focus on psychological research and teaching / lecturing.
